Grace, a Standard Industries company, is a leading global supplier of catalysts, engineered materials and fine chemicals. We provide innovative products, technologies and services which our customers use to manufacture everyday products like renewable fuels, pharmaceuticals, toothpaste, cosmetics, food packaging, beer, edible oils and more. Our thousands of employees help shape a better future at our global headquarters in Columbia, MD and locations worldwide.
Job Description
Grace is hiring a Process Technology (PT) Engineer to join our Specialty Catalyst Process Technology team.
The PT Engineer provides scale-up and technical support for product development and commercialization. They also support the optimization and cost-savings efforts and will leverage your technical expertise to solve complex problems.
The Process Technology Engineer is on-site in Baton Rouge, LA and reports to the Process Technology Manager.
Responsibilities
- Work safely in an industrial atmosphere and champion a strong safety culture
- Develop and implement projects to increase plant productivity, decrease production costs, and improve overall EHS performance
- Work closely with process chemists to drive continuous improvement
- Provide support for production campaigns by conducting appropriate Process Hazards Analysis, compilation of technical documentation, and direct unit support
- Own commercialization process by completing technology transfers to drive products to routine operation
- Assist in troubleshooting requests from manufacturing team in support of commercial products
- Lead start-up and commissioning efforts
